Description:
Constructed of sturdy steel, these car dollies are designed to withstand the weight of your car for easy maneuverability. Each car dolly individually can hold up to 1,500 lbs. and feature four swivel casters to allow you to shift and move your project anywhere in your garage with ease. These rust-resistant car dollies are a must-have for anyone working on a car at home and the professional auto worker alike!

    Heavy duty steel construction for strength and durability
    Each car dolly has four swivel casters, 2 standard and 2 with locking brakes
    1500 lbs. maximum load capacity each
    Rust resistant finish

Max load capacity: 1500 lb. each
Overall dimensions: 16" L x 11-7/8" W x 4" H
Weight per dolly: 35.12 lb.
Assembly required.

Race-car driver Scott Pruett is also a winemaker, and his vineyard is releasing a limited-edition Napa Cabernet to celebrate the 100th anniversary of the Indianapolis 500. Pruett and his wife, Judy, opened their vineyard in 2006 in Auburn, Calif., on the eastern slope of the northern Sierra Mountains. They create small-lot, hand-crafted premium wines.

We have the first interior photos of the 2014 Mercedes S Class ahead of its debut in May 2013, showing a much more modern interior. But now, with a reveal of the new S Class just a couple of months off, we have the first photos of the interior of the new S Class showing a  car that keeps much of the layout of the current S Class but adds in more curves, more technology, a more modern look and a more upmarket feel than ever before. The cabin flows from the screen in to the doors in the same sort of seamless way it does an the Jaguar XJ – where it makes the cabin feel more spacious – the instrument panel is a huge digital display, the seats are differently contoured and trimmed, there seems to be more room, better lighting and an altogether more upmarket feel for Mercedes range topper.
